Gold Beach and Nesika Beach are places in Oregon.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Gold Beach has the higher population (2,455 vs 496 in Nesika Beach). Nesika Beach has the higher median household income ($87,712 vs $51,662 in Gold Beach). Nesika Beach has the higher median home value ($369,700 vs $368,900 in Gold Beach).
